Microsoft VBScript runtime error '800a01fb'

02/12/2003 - 22:26 por Israel Ochoa P. | Informe spam
Hola! espero me puedan ayudar, tengo un problema con una
página ASP, que se conecta a una Base de Datos SQL 2000, y
me arroja este error Microsoft VBScript runtime
error '800a01fb' este error ocurre cuando se realiza el
open de un Recordset, pero no en todas las ocaciones, el
servidor WEB es un Windows 2000 Server, alquien me puede
decir a que se puede deber o como solucionarlo.

ATTE: OPI

Preguntas similare

Leer las respuestas

#6 Daniel Álvarez
05/12/2003 - 09:02 | Informe spam
´Tambien leí que podia ser cosa del mdactype, actualizatelo desde:

http://tinyurl.com/iza5

Pero ya te aviso que es por probar, suerte!!

Daniel Álvarez




"Israel Ochoa Perez" escribió en el
mensaje news:d23701c3baa1$ee91cf20$
Pues ya intentamos esa opcion y nos sucede lo mismo la
verdad es que ya no sabemos que es, ya llevamos 1 semana
con este problema

Saludos
Curioso, parece ser un error no comun he encontrado esto:

Microsoft VBScript runtime error '800a01fb'
An exception occurred: 'Open'
This error can happen when you use an ADODB.Recordset to


retrieve a
resultset, and the resultset is empty.
Switching from ADODB.Recordset to conn.execute(sql) seems


to alleviate this
problem.

Pues eso, prueba a cargar el recordset via con.execute o


mejor usa un objeto
command.

Daniel Álvarez
-



"Israel Ochoa P."


escribió en el
mensaje news:0cbe01c3b9b1$c6b35fa0$
Este es el código que me esta causando el problema
strSQL = "exec sp_s_FechaUltimoIndice "

SET rsUltFechaIndice = Server.CreateObject
("ADODB.Recordset")
rsUltFechaIndice.Open strSQL ,Application
("strConn"),adOpenStatic

y como les comento este error no sucede siempre, sucede
aveces si y aveces no y para que deje de suceder por X
tiempo lo que hemos hecho es darle reset al servidor y
vuelve a funcionar correctamente, pero solo durante un
tiempo ya que después vuelve a fallar nuevamente. Gracias
por su ayuda.

ATTE: OPI



Mandanos el codigo de la pagina que produce el error,


concretamente mandanos
el open con la sentencia sql.


Daniel Álvarez





-



"Israel Ochoa P."


escribió en el
mensaje news:02a401c3b91a$f92b0420$
Hola! espero me puedan ayudar, tengo un problema con una
página ASP, que se conecta a una Base de Datos SQL 2000,




y
me arroja este error Microsoft VBScript runtime
error '800a01fb' este error ocurre cuando se realiza el
open de un Recordset, pero no en todas las ocaciones, el
servidor WEB es un Windows 2000 Server, alquien me puede
decir a que se puede deber o como solucionarlo.

ATTE: OPI


.





.

Respuesta Responder a este mensaje
#7 Israel Ochoa P.
08/12/2003 - 18:03 | Informe spam
Ya instalamos el MDAC 2.7 y 2.8 y tampoco tuvimos
resultado, sigue fallando, espero tengas por ahi algo más
que podamos probar

Saludos y muchas gracias por tu ayuda
ŽTambien leí que podia ser cosa del mdactype,


actualizatelo desde:

http://tinyurl.com/iza5

Pero ya te aviso que es por probar, suerte!!

Daniel Álvarez
-



"Israel Ochoa Perez"


escribió en el
mensaje news:d23701c3baa1$ee91cf20$
Pues ya intentamos esa opcion y nos sucede lo mismo la
verdad es que ya no sabemos que es, ya llevamos 1 semana
con este problema

Saludos
Curioso, parece ser un error no comun he encontrado esto:

Microsoft VBScript runtime error '800a01fb'
An exception occurred: 'Open'
This error can happen when you use an ADODB.Recordset to


retrieve a
resultset, and the resultset is empty.
Switching from ADODB.Recordset to conn.execute(sql) seems


to alleviate this
problem.

Pues eso, prueba a cargar el recordset via con.execute o


mejor usa un objeto
command.

Daniel Álvarez





-



"Israel Ochoa P."


escribió en el
mensaje news:0cbe01c3b9b1$c6b35fa0$
Este es el código que me esta causando el problema
strSQL = "exec sp_s_FechaUltimoIndice "

SET rsUltFechaIndice = Server.CreateObject
("ADODB.Recordset")
rsUltFechaIndice.Open strSQL ,Application
("strConn"),adOpenStatic

y como les comento este error no sucede siempre, sucede
aveces si y aveces no y para que deje de suceder por X
tiempo lo que hemos hecho es darle reset al servidor y
vuelve a funcionar correctamente, pero solo durante un
tiempo ya que después vuelve a fallar nuevamente. Gracias
por su ayuda.

ATTE: OPI



Mandanos el codigo de la pagina que produce el error,


concretamente mandanos
el open con la sentencia sql.


Daniel Álvarez






-
-



"Israel Ochoa P."


escribió en el
mensaje news:02a401c3b91a$f92b0420$
Hola! espero me puedan ayudar, tengo un problema con una
página ASP, que se conecta a una Base de Datos SQL 2000,




y
me arroja este error Microsoft VBScript runtime
error '800a01fb' este error ocurre cuando se realiza el
open de un Recordset, pero no en todas las ocaciones, el
servidor WEB es un Windows 2000 Server, alquien me puede
decir a que se puede deber o como solucionarlo.

ATTE: OPI


.





.





.

Respuesta Responder a este mensaje
#8 Daniel Álvarez
09/12/2003 - 09:21 | Informe spam
Pues siento decirte que no tengo nada mas no he econtrado nada mas referente
a eso, de todas maneras te recomiendo que cuando te de error compruebes como
te han dicho que valor guarda application no vaya a ser que este vacio y te
de error por eso.

Daniel Álvarez




"Israel Ochoa P." escribió en el
mensaje news:018401c3bdad$3b687840$
Ya instalamos el MDAC 2.7 y 2.8 y tampoco tuvimos
resultado, sigue fallando, espero tengas por ahi algo más
que podamos probar

Saludos y muchas gracias por tu ayuda
´Tambien leí que podia ser cosa del mdactype,


actualizatelo desde:

http://tinyurl.com/iza5

Pero ya te aviso que es por probar, suerte!!

Daniel Álvarez
-



"Israel Ochoa Perez"


escribió en el
mensaje news:d23701c3baa1$ee91cf20$
Pues ya intentamos esa opcion y nos sucede lo mismo la
verdad es que ya no sabemos que es, ya llevamos 1 semana
con este problema

Saludos
Curioso, parece ser un error no comun he encontrado esto:

Microsoft VBScript runtime error '800a01fb'
An exception occurred: 'Open'
This error can happen when you use an ADODB.Recordset to


retrieve a
resultset, and the resultset is empty.
Switching from ADODB.Recordset to conn.execute(sql) seems


to alleviate this
problem.

Pues eso, prueba a cargar el recordset via con.execute o


mejor usa un objeto
command.

Daniel Álvarez





-



"Israel Ochoa P."


escribió en el
mensaje news:0cbe01c3b9b1$c6b35fa0$
Este es el código que me esta causando el problema
strSQL = "exec sp_s_FechaUltimoIndice "

SET rsUltFechaIndice = Server.CreateObject
("ADODB.Recordset")
rsUltFechaIndice.Open strSQL ,Application
("strConn"),adOpenStatic

y como les comento este error no sucede siempre, sucede
aveces si y aveces no y para que deje de suceder por X
tiempo lo que hemos hecho es darle reset al servidor y
vuelve a funcionar correctamente, pero solo durante un
tiempo ya que después vuelve a fallar nuevamente. Gracias
por su ayuda.

ATTE: OPI



Mandanos el codigo de la pagina que produce el error,


concretamente mandanos
el open con la sentencia sql.


Daniel Álvarez






-
-



"Israel Ochoa P."


escribió en el
mensaje news:02a401c3b91a$f92b0420$
Hola! espero me puedan ayudar, tengo un problema con una
página ASP, que se conecta a una Base de Datos SQL 2000,




y
me arroja este error Microsoft VBScript runtime
error '800a01fb' este error ocurre cuando se realiza el
open de un Recordset, pero no en todas las ocaciones, el
servidor WEB es un Windows 2000 Server, alquien me puede
decir a que se puede deber o como solucionarlo.

ATTE: OPI


.





.





.

Respuesta Responder a este mensaje
#9 Jhonny Vargas P. [MVP]
10/12/2003 - 13:06 | Informe spam
Hola,

Prueba creando dos objetos, uno de coneccion y el otro del recordset.

Dim objConnection, objRecordSet
Set objConnection = Server.CreateObject("ADODB.Connection")
objConnection.Open Application ("strConn")

Set objRecordSet = objConnection.Execute(SQL)


Set objRecordSet = Nothing

Set objConnection = Nothing

También mandanos tu cadena del string de conección (cambiando el usuario
y la password...)


Saludos,
Jhonny Vargas P. [MS MVP]
Santiago de Chile



"Daniel Álvarez" wrote in message
news:
Pues siento decirte que no tengo nada mas no he econtrado nada mas


referente
a eso, de todas maneras te recomiendo que cuando te de error compruebes


como
te han dicho que valor guarda application no vaya a ser que este vacio y


te
de error por eso.

Daniel Álvarez




"Israel Ochoa P." escribió en el
mensaje news:018401c3bdad$3b687840$
Ya instalamos el MDAC 2.7 y 2.8 y tampoco tuvimos
resultado, sigue fallando, espero tengas por ahi algo más
que podamos probar

Saludos y muchas gracias por tu ayuda
>´Tambien leí que podia ser cosa del mdactype,
actualizatelo desde:
>
>http://tinyurl.com/iza5
>
>Pero ya te aviso que es por probar, suerte!!
>
>Daniel Álvarez
>-
>
>
>
>"Israel Ochoa Perez"
escribió en el
>mensaje news:d23701c3baa1$ee91cf20$
>Pues ya intentamos esa opcion y nos sucede lo mismo la
>verdad es que ya no sabemos que es, ya llevamos 1 semana
>con este problema
>
>Saludos
>>Curioso, parece ser un error no comun he encontrado esto:
>>
>>Microsoft VBScript runtime error '800a01fb'
>>An exception occurred: 'Open'
>>This error can happen when you use an ADODB.Recordset to
>retrieve a
>>resultset, and the resultset is empty.
>>Switching from ADODB.Recordset to conn.execute(sql) seems
>to alleviate this
>>problem.
>>
>>Pues eso, prueba a cargar el recordset via con.execute o
>mejor usa un objeto
>>command.
>>
>>Daniel Álvarez
>>
-
>>
>>
>>
>>"Israel Ochoa P."
>escribió en el
>>mensaje news:0cbe01c3b9b1$c6b35fa0$
>>Este es el código que me esta causando el problema
>>strSQL = "exec sp_s_FechaUltimoIndice "
>>
>>SET rsUltFechaIndice = Server.CreateObject
>>("ADODB.Recordset")
>>rsUltFechaIndice.Open strSQL ,Application
>>("strConn"),adOpenStatic
>>
>>y como les comento este error no sucede siempre, sucede
>>aveces si y aveces no y para que deje de suceder por X
>>tiempo lo que hemos hecho es darle reset al servidor y
>>vuelve a funcionar correctamente, pero solo durante un
>>tiempo ya que después vuelve a fallar nuevamente. Gracias
>>por su ayuda.
>>
>>>ATTE: OPI
>>
>>>Mandanos el codigo de la pagina que produce el error,
>>concretamente mandanos
>>>el open con la sentencia sql.
>>>
>>>
>>>Daniel Álvarez
-
>-
>>>
>>>
>>>
>>>"Israel Ochoa P."
>>escribió en el
>>>mensaje news:02a401c3b91a$f92b0420$
>>>Hola! espero me puedan ayudar, tengo un problema con una
>>>página ASP, que se conecta a una Base de Datos SQL 2000,
>y
>>>me arroja este error Microsoft VBScript runtime
>>>error '800a01fb' este error ocurre cuando se realiza el
>>>open de un Recordset, pero no en todas las ocaciones, el
>>>servidor WEB es un Windows 2000 Server, alquien me puede
>>>decir a que se puede deber o como solucionarlo.
>>>
>>>ATTE: OPI
>>>
>>>
>>>.
>>>
>>
>>
>>.
>>
>
>
>.
>


email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una pregunta AnteriorRespuesta Tengo una respuesta
Search Busqueda sugerida